Desuri Carpet

Desuri in Barley has a warm, pale beige ground with softly blended ivory and taupe flecks. Its close, looped texture gives the surface a gently nubby, tactile character.

About this fabric

This Barley colourway reads as a mellow oat-beige rather than a cool stone neutral, with small tonal variations creating quiet depth across the surface. Fine horizontal rows of compact loops form the visible texture, while ivory highlights catch the light between warmer taupe and barley tones. The restrained, mottled appearance keeps the fabric understated but prevents the pale colour from looking flat. Catalogued as a Carpet, it has a substantial-looking woven character that suits upholstery-led applications.

How to use it

Use Barley on a relaxed armchair, ottoman or upholstered headboard alongside natural timber, creamy linens and warm stone finishes. Its softly golden beige tone also works as a calm neutral against deeper olive, rust or chocolate accents.

A warm, softly flecked neutral with a tactile looped surface for relaxed upholstery schemes.
